In general, what is the effect if increased temperature on the solubility of a gas

Respuesta :

12210443 12210443
  • 10-10-2018

Increased temperature causes an increase in kinetic energy. The higher kinetic energy causes more motion in the gas molecules which break intermolecular bonds and escape from solution.
